That makes sense. I only watch football in SDR and am under 150 nits.It is very dependant on settings used. Those of us running SDR under 150-ish nits won’t see it because the dimming algorithm only kicks in around this threshold - so while it’s possible you’ve never seen it, the behaviour is there on all Sony OLEDs (and I’m sure on others, I’ve just not owned them to verify).
To the original poster - the short answer is no there is no setting that eliminates this behaviour as it is part of the TV protecting itself from image retention (caused by the static scoreboard in the football, most likely). You can stop it from doing it however by lowering a combination of the Brightness and Peak Luminance setting - from memory I think Brightness on 20 with Peak Luminance on Medium will be about the highest it can go before these protection measures kick in.
